Higher penalties, broader definitions, and national standards: Did harmonized Australian workplace health and safety laws reduce workers' compensation receipt?

Anam Bilgrami; Henry Cutler; Kompal Sinha · 2024 · Industrial Relations: A Journal of Economy and Society
